Re: tranny fluid

how much life does it take off the fluid if the engine is over heated? since there is a cooler in the rad it will effect the fluid wont it? i broke a fan belt and ran it overheated for about 10-15 min.

Re: tranny fluid

and overheating engine will heat the trans fluid as well.i would pull the dipstick and look at the fluid. if its birght cherry red dont worry about it. if its turning brownish change it. all manufacturers now reccomend a transmission flush every 30,000 miles. vehicles that have this done have transmissions that live a lot longer.
